• I see many queries on here regarding the backup timing out after many attemps.

    It keeps retrying after being inactive for 5 minutes, so my question is WHY is it inactive?? I have tried following the suggestions of increasing the time to 300 seconds and have increased the number of attemps that can be made from 3 to 5; however this does not resolve the issue.

    The backup works fine but the archive is the problem. I see my database is only 19 MB as it’s a small site and it should be going to my DropBox, so it’s not the size of the file from what I can tell.

    Can you please give some other suggestions as to why it’s not working other than to increase the limit to 300 seconds.

  • The message means the BackWPup checks the running of the backup job and has found out that the job has no progress since 5 Minutes. The cames normely if the jo hase terminated or crached on server side.

    BackWPup that starts the job again on the step where it would terminated.

    The problem ist that mostly we can’t say why it is terminated. In the new Version i have added some more checks for termination but it must tested.

    Somtimes it depends on some folder or files that can’t be backuped. You can find this by exluding files and filder and do some tests.
    Somtiems it comes from that the backup archive goes to large. Strato allows only 64MB, some file system only 2GB. You can see thi if you look with you FTP programm in the Temp Folder of BackWPup.

    You can check this first.

    you schuld decresing the maximum Execution time in BAckWPup > Steeing > Tab: Jobs to 30 secounds. It schuld be a time lower than the maximum PHP Execution time.
